Desenvolvimento e usabilidade de aplicativo para planejamento de reabilitação oral com implantes unitários

2019 
The worldwide spread of smartphones has proven to be an increasingly consolidated reality because it is an easy-to-use, portable and versatile tool when used with the currently available applications in several areas. In health area has not been different, as several educational and informative applications have emerged in all areas. The objective of this study was to develop and validate a smartphone application that can work as a improver and guideline for the dentist in his planning for the treatment of patients with osseointegrated single implants from patient selection to prosthetic planning through surgical planning. The common sense on the management of patients with the most varied physiological profiles, as well as the most conspicuous surgical techniques for the anatomical improvement, as well as the several types of prosthetic solutions available in the current trading, have been sought in the literature. First, a previous research with 20implantologistswas done to understand how important it would be in the professional's daily life, an application that could serve as a guide for anamnesis, that could create lines of surgical treatment according to the anatomical-physiological profile of the patient and to create solutions prosthetic according to the result of the surgical phase. All of them stated that it would be very useful to use a tool with these characteristics. The technical development of the application was carried out for Android® system in partnership with the Laboratories of Technological Innovations (LIT), of the Christus University Center, in Portuguese and not linked to any company or website. The application was developed in the form of a step-by-step guide that will guide the user from the patient's register, to the prosthetic solution. A System Usability Scale (SUS) questionnaire and a self-designed questionnaire to evaluate the usability of the tool as an adjunct to the conventional method of work were applied to 23 implantology specialists and implantology students who used the app to solve an aleatory case achievinga80,9% score. As conclusions the application has proved interactive and didactic tool for planning and database besides scientifically base the professional in the treatment with unit implants and still proved to be very practical and usable for all participants.
